Briton Ferry weather in May

In May, Briton Ferry sees average daytime highs of 15°C and overnight lows near 7°C, with 100 mm of precipitation across 14.8 wet days and about 15.3 hours of daylight. It is the 5th-warmest and 9th-wettest month of the year here.

Highs climb over the month, from about 13°C in the first days to 16°C by the end.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 13% of the time in May, and the air most often feels dry.

Daylight stretches from about 14 h 30 min at the start of May to 16 hours by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, May is Briton Ferry's 2nd-clearest and 8th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Briton Ferry's year-round climate.

Temperature in May

Average highAverage lowShaded bands: 10–90% of days

Highs climb over the month, from about 13°C in the first days to 16°C by the end.

A typical May day in Briton Ferry reaches about 15°C in the afternoon and slips back to 7°C overnight — a 7°C sp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 11°C and 19°C. Set against its neighbours, May runs about 3°C warmer than April and about 2°C cooler than June.

Sunrise & sunset in May

DaylightNight

Daylight runs from about 14 h 30 min at the start of May to 16 hours by month's end. The lit band spans sunrise to sunset each day.

Days grow by about 90 minutes over May. Sunrise moves from 4:56 AM to 4:12 AM, and sunset from 7:29 PM to 8:13 PM.

Sea temperature near Briton Ferry in May

The nearest coast averages about 11°C in May — the other half of the beach question. The full-year curve and swim-comfort zones are below.

The sea offshore is warmest in August at about 18°C and coldest in February near 8°C.

The water stays below 20°C all year — cool enough that most swimmers want a wetsuit.

Location & terrain

Where is Briton Ferry?

Briton Ferry sits at 51.6°N, 3.8°W, 25 m above sea level, in United Kingdom. The nearest listed city is Neath, 4.0 km away.

Topography around Briton Ferry

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Briton Ferry.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Briton Ferry has signific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 314 m around an average of 61 m above sea level; within 16 km, signific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 553 m; within 80 km, large vari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 878 m.

The land around Briton Ferry is covered by trees (39%), grassland (31%) and artificial surfaces (22%) within 3 km, trees (36%), grassland (30%) and water (24%) within 16 km, and grassland (48%) and water (31%) within 80 km.
